The Consumer Rights Act 2015

 


LETTING FEES
Our letting service includes initial advice upon rental value, advertising for and securing a suitable tenant, taking up references for approval, preparing an inventory of furniture, fixtures and effects included in the tenancy, preparing the Tenancy Agreement and Counterpart, completing the matter and holding the tenant’s deposit under the Tenancy Deposit Scheme.  It also includes the cost of serving notice requiring possession at the end of the tenancy, and checking the inventory on the tenant’s departure.
The fees for this service are as follows:
    Rents up to £1,000 per calendar month – one month’s rent inclusive of VAT.
    Rents between £1,000 - £1,500 per month - £1,200 (inclusive of VAT)
    Rents over £1,500 per month –  £1,800 (inclusive of VAT)


RENEWAL OF TENANCY AGREEMENTS
Where an existing Tenancy Agreement is renewed, the fee payable by Landlords on each occasion is £240 (inclusive of VAT)


TENANTS FEES
No fees are payable by Tenants.


MANAGEMENT FEES
Where full management of properties is undertaken, Landlords are not required to pay any letting fees.  The management fee is 18%  of the rent collected inclusive of VAT, which includes the services set out above under the heading Letting Fees, and in addition, the collection of rent and accounting to Landlords, arranging for any necessary repairs or servicing, dealing with Gas Safety Certificates, discharging outgoings in the nature of insurance, periodic inspections of the property, dealing with all correspondence, letting and re-letting of the property and renewal of existing Tenancy Agreements.


CLIENT MONEY PROTECTION SCHEME
All clients’ money is protected under the scheme operated by our professional body The Royal Institution of Chartered Surveyors.  


REDRESS SCHEME
This firm is a member of the Redress Scheme for consumers operated by Ombudsman Services: Property. 


TENANTS’ DEPOSITS
All tenants’ deposits are protected under the scheme operated by the Dispute Service Limited.
